Input-output norms require imported inputs to match specified proportions for manufacture of declared export products under FTP.
The instrument itemises constituent inputs with specified weights per unit of resultant product, identifying raw materials and establishing the allowable input mix to be used in production. The schedule requires applicants and importers to ensure imported goods correspond to those actually required and used in the declared export product, authorising determination of permissible proportions and verification for conformity with the input output norms under FTP.
